#6 Federal Procurement Data
System
FPDS-NG (“next generation”) – you
should have seen first generation ;-)
www.fpds.gov/fpdsng_cms/
Google-type search for agency or
contractor name, NAICS, PSC, etc
Drill-down to get more detail
9. www.setasidealert.com 9
#7 Better yet:
www.USASpending.gov
Official contract awards data
Same data as FPDS-NG, but more user-
friendly interface
Search by NAICS, agency, keyword,
company
Research your competitors or suppliers

#9 Confirm your SAM and DSBS
listings
Transition of data from CCR to SAM was a
mess
Small business data not getting passed
through to SBA’s Dynamic SB Search
Today, log in and review your SAM entry
and be sure to go on to DSBS
Add keywords, past performance to DSBS
12. www.setasidealert.com 12
#10 GSA Schedule a necessity?
Commonly-used, off-the-shelf products
and services
$40 billion in purchases that rarely appear
in FedBizOpps
For description of what’s covered:
www.gsa.gov/schedulesolicitations
Transition from MFC to Fair & Reasonable
